21. “
“The phone has some features (such as ringtones) where
the manual doesn’t tell you how to set them. I had to
contact their helpline, only to find out that the settings are
hidden behind a screwed-on panel.
There are speed dial buttons, but you can see from
the picture of the phone that there isn’t a place beside
the buttons to write names (they are 5mm apart). This
phone seems to me to have poor usability overall.
I wouldn’t buy it again. In fact, I’m shopping for
a replacement, and I’ve only had this about 2 months.”
The→Amazon.co.uk→user→“TreeHouseCoach”→(Oxford)
